In this episode, Kate Pearce discusses why the common advice of eating six small meals a day is outdated and detrimental to weight loss efforts.
When Sarah first reached out, she was nervous. She'd been told by previous coaches that weight loss meant eating six small meals a day and never skipping breakfast. She was exhausted just thinking about it. But here's the truth - that advice is outdated, unsustainable and scientifically flawed.
